メインフレームの移行の最大のリスクはベテラン技術者の退職と技術継承


タイトルだけで全て終わりそうだけどw、まあいいか。

メインフレームの事情について興味深く読んだ。
メインフレーム=ホストが最近では崩れ始めてるのはそのとおりだと思うし、
ホストが圧倒的な高可用性が出せるのも事実だと思う。
実際ちょっと前にホストの人と話をしたときには、最近のオープン系の進化も凄いけど
ホストまわりの進化も並じゃないって言ってた。ハードウェアの進化の恩恵はかけられるコストと比例したりするので、
オープン系よりもホストなどの方がより直接的に受けれるっていうのもあると思う。


唯一違和感あったのは人材についてのところかな。

続きを読む

まるでServlet3.0です。本当にありが(ry

T2をServlet3.0風に使ってみた。
多分これが一番プリミティブな使い方だと思う。


以下の例だと、通常のWebアプリからはGET/POSTなので、@Defaultがついたメソッドは
呼ばれることはないです。リクエストしたときも@GETのほうが呼ばれる。
HEADとかTRACEとかPUTとかすると、@Defaultのメソッドが呼ばれます。

/**
 * This example shows you T2 can do like Servlet3.0:P
 * 
 * @author shot
 * 
 */
@RequestScope
@Page("getandpost")
public class GetAndPostPage {

	@Default
	public Navigation index(TeedaContext context) {
		System.out.println("called");
		return Redirect.to("jsp/simpleGetAndPost.jsp");
	}

	@POST
	public Navigation post(HttpServletRequest request,
			HttpServletResponse response) {
		request.setAttribute("message", "Do POST.");
		return Forward.to("jsp/simpleGetAndPost.jsp");
	}

	@GET
	public Navigation get(HttpServletRequest request,
			HttpServletResponse response) {
		request.setAttribute("message", "Do GET.");
		return Forward.to("jsp/simpleGetAndPost.jsp");
	}

}

Silverlightを囲む会in大阪#3


今週土曜開催のSilverlightを囲む会in大阪#3に参加してきます!
たまたまFlex勉強会とのコラボ企画みたいなので、SilverlightだけでなくFlexも見れちゃうお得企画!
なんかラッキー^_^v


もしや10年ぶりくらいの大阪かも。すげー楽しみです!
皆さんよろしくお願いしますm(_ _)m